Formula Used
Width of Heptagon = 1*Long Diagonal of Heptagon
w = 1*dLong
This formula uses 2 Variables
Variables Used
Width of Heptagon - (Measured in Meter) - The Width of Heptagon is the horizontal distance from the left most edge to the right most edge of the Regular Heptagon.
Long Diagonal of Heptagon - (Measured in Meter) - Long Diagonal of Heptagon is the straight line joining two non-adjacent vertices which is across three sides of the Heptagon.

What is a Heptagon?

Heptagon is a polygon with seven sides and seven vertices. Like any polygon, a Heptagon may be either convex or concave, as illustrated in the next figure. When it is convex, all its interior angles are lower than 180°. On the other hand, when its is concave, one or more of its interior angles is larger than 180°. When all the edges of the Heptagon are equal then it is called equilateral.

How many ways are there to calculate Width of Heptagon?
In this formula, Width of Heptagon uses Long Diagonal of Heptagon. We can use 7 other way(s) to calculate the same, which is/are as follows -
  • Width of Heptagon = Side of Heptagon/(2*sin(((pi/2))/7))
  • Width of Heptagon = Circumradius of Heptagon*sin(pi/7)/sin(((pi/2))/7)
  • Width of Heptagon = Inradius of Heptagon*tan(pi/7)/sin(((pi/2))/7)
  • Width of Heptagon = sqrt((4*tan(pi/7))/7*Area of Heptagon)/(2*sin(((pi/2))/7))
  • Width of Heptagon = Perimeter of Heptagon/(14*sin(((pi/2))/7))
  • Width of Heptagon = Short Diagonal of Heptagon/(4*sin(((pi/2))/7)*cos(pi/7))
  • Width of Heptagon = Height of Heptagon*tan(((pi/2))/7)/sin(((pi/2))/7)
